WebWhen milky spore disease becomes established, it will spread naturally to adjoining, untreated areas. Application at the time of turf installation may result in a more uniform distribution of the spores in the soil. Milky disease is a pathologica1 condition of scarabeid larvae caused by an infection with either Bacillus popilliae Dutky or B. lentimorbus Dutky. Bacterial spores were introduced into Delaware in the early 1940’s for control of Popillia japonica Newman.
